UC

Presence와 DB연동시 postgreSQL 설정방법

말없는채플린씨 2013. 8. 23. 17:17


QUERY 문 작성 

1. CREATE ROLE pchatuser LOGIN CREATEDB;

    ALTER ROLE pchatuser WITH SUPERUSER; 

    CREATE DATABASE pchat WITH OWNER pchatuser ENCODING 'UTF8';

    ALTER ROLE pchatuser WITH PASSWORD 'lhy623123';


2. CREATE ROLE compuser LOGIN CREATEDB;

    ALTER ROLE compuser WITH SUPERUSER; 

    CREATE DATABASE comp WITH OWNER compuser ENCODING 'UTF8';

    ALTER ROLE compuser WITH PASSWORD 'lhy623123';


3. 환경설정 파일 수정(pg_hba.conf) 

    <install_dir>/data/pg_hba.conf 파일 수정 실시 


     host comp compuser [PostgreSQL IP]/24 password

     host pchat pchatuser [PostgreSQL IP]/24 password


4. 환경설정 파일 수정 (postgresql.conf)

    escape_string_warning = off

    standard_conforming_strings = off


5. postSQL Database를 Reflesh를 실시해야 한다.